WebHow do you remove triethylamine from a compound? - Distillation may work if the product or mixture of products are stable in the distillation conditions. If so, vacuum distillation may work fine. The use of co-solvents cal also help and depending on the desired final level of triethylamine you can apply stripping with nitrogen of vapour.

WebSep 28, 2011 · CAS: 121-44-8; Chemical Formula: (C 2 H 5) 3 N. OSHA previously had a limit of 25 ppm TWA for triethylamine. Based on the ACGIH recommendation, the Agency proposed revising this limit to 10 ppm as a TWA and 15 ppm as a 15-minute STEL for this colorless liquid with a strong, ammonia-like odor.
